About Peter Vortisch

Peter Vortisch is a scholar working on Transportation, Automotive Engineering, Building and Construction, Control and Systems Engineering and Sociology and Political Science, having authored 148 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Transportation Planning and Optimization (77 papers), Transportation and Mobility Innovations (61 papers), Urban Transport and Accessibility (57 papers), Traffic control and management (28 papers), Human Mobility and Location-Based Analysis (26 papers), Traffic Prediction and Management Techniques (20 papers), Urban and Freight Transport Logistics (18 papers) and Vehicle emissions and performance (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Transportation (843 citations), Automotive Engineering (631 citations), Building and Construction (347 citations), Control and Systems Engineering (404 citations) and Marketing (132 citations). Peter Vortisch has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Australia and United States. Frequent co-authors include Martin Kagerbauer, Bastian Chlond, Nicolai Mallig, Martin Fellendorf, Michael Heilig, Carlos Sun, Tom V. Mathew, Christine Eisenmann, Fritz Busch and Marcel Hunecke. Their work appears in journals such as Transportation Research Record Journal of the Transportation Research Board, European Transport Research Review, Transportation Research Interdisciplinary Perspectives, Travel Behaviour and Society and Future Generation Computer Systems.
